logo

Output ed5a9037292c46fbd2bdf8372802d5b9bb429fcbe10ac8cb17739481b7a7ad6c:36

value
423380167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c1d40b01b2d7224fe812a680badf0edcdad88ec OP_EQUAL
address
3BYfwmqEbz5hgDC7d7dwHvsdLYicbgkJLn
transaction
ed5a9037292c46fbd2bdf8372802d5b9bb429fcbe10ac8cb17739481b7a7ad6c